Understanding Freight Shipping on eBay


How to Ship Freight Weight Items on eBay - LiveAbout - ship freight on ebay

Freight shipping is typically used for large, heavy, or bulky items that cannot be shipped through standard postal services. This can include furniture, appliances, or machinery. Here’s a quick overview of how freight shipping works on eBay:

  • Freight carriers: These are specialized shipping companies that handle large and heavy shipments.
  • Shipping classes: Freight shipping often involves different classes based on the size, weight, and nature of the item.
  • Cost calculation: The cost of freight shipping can vary widely based on distance, weight, dimensions, and chosen shipping method.

Cost Considerations for Freight Shipping

Understanding the costs involved in freight shipping is crucial. Here are some key factors to consider:

  • Weight and Dimensions: Heavier and larger items usually incur higher shipping costs.
  • Distance: The further the shipment travels, the more expensive it typically becomes.
  • Type of Freight: LTL shipments are often less expensive than FTL shipments, depending on the item and shipping route.
  • Insurance and Extras: Consider additional costs for insurance or special handling if the item is valuable or fragile.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

What is freight shipping?
Freight shipping is a method used to transport large, heavy, or bulky items that cannot be sent through standard postal services.

How do I calculate freight shipping costs on eBay?
You can use eBay’s shipping calculator or consult with freight carriers to get quotes based on the item’s weight, dimensions, and shipping distance.

Can I ship furniture using eBay freight shipping?
Yes, freight shipping is commonly used for furniture and other large items. Ensure you provide accurate dimensions and weight in your listing.

What should I do if my freight shipment is damaged?
Contact the freight carrier immediately to report the damage and file a claim if necessary. Keep all packaging materials for inspection.
